当Fluent-EDEM耦合过程中由于意外情况导致软件意外关闭,耦合中断的情况,可以通过读取fluent和EDEM的自动保存的数据文件恢复耦合,但直接读取自动保存的数据文件后,可能出现耦合失败、直接发散等问题下面是笔者学习到的可以解决上述问题的方法。
- 打开fluent最新的自动保存的case文件和EDEM,以Fluent保存的最新的case文件的时间步为准,计算当前Fluent计算到什么时间,将EDEM的Fixed time step调整到对应的时间步(注:一般要求EDEM计算时间步要小于Fluent的计算时间步,因此耦合意外断开的时候,EDEM的计算时间一定是比Fluent自动保存的时间更长的)。
- 将调整后的EDEM方案保存,舍弃多余的时间步,然后打开EDEM的耦合开关。
- 在Fluent中打开EDEM耦合截面,开启耦合,同步时间步,查看Fluent和EDEM的当前计算时间是否一致,若不一致,则需要重新回到第一步。
- 进入Fluent的Run Calculation界面,如图所示,首先点击Calculation运行一次,当出现3所指的信息,点击2所指的Stop at end of the iteration,停止迭代,再点击Calculation进行计算即可正常计算。